FSS for more than twice as many films at Rio 2009

EFP at the Rio International Film Festival
24 September – 8 October 2009

With rising numbers of sales agents requesting promotional backing for their European films throughout 2009 at selected festivals and markets, applications for the Rio International Film Festival total 15 in comparison to seven in the previous year. FSS is one of European Film Promotion's (EFP) successful initiatives boosting the circulation of European film and spotlighting talent outside of Europe. Since its beginning in 2004, FSS has continuously been funded by the MEDIA Programme of the European Union.

The easy-to-access scheme covers up to 50% of costs for the promotional campaigns at the festival. Altogether, 12 feature films and 3 documentaries are benefitting from FSS this year, amongst them Katalin Varga from Romania, The Home of Dark Butterflies from Finland, Little Soldier from Denmark, Another Man from Switzerland, Amalia the Movie from Portugal and The Sea Wall from France, to name just a few. Eight different sales agents and three production companies are in Rio with the help of FSS to present and promote their films.

"As European films have to compete for the attention of international buyers and the press, we are all too aware what a great opportunity FSS presents for sellers. It is little money by comparison but it will make all the difference", says EFP President Éva Vezér. "In particular, producers without a sales agent would find it difficult to attend festivals outside of Europe."
